Closest I can tell you is that I have an MSI K8t "neo/platinum" board [nvidia chipset] and I'm running SATA drives in a soft-raid [striped] / LVM configuration. (and yes, even for /boot, though technically /boot isn't part of LVM, it is just an md device) I never really got the "on-board" part of the so-called hardware raid to ever work, so after an hour or two of screwing with it, I finally realized/justified the fact that since Linux does the RAID stuff automatically, I might as well use it that way instead. It turns out that after all was said and done, I re-read the documentation and found out that "even under windows..." the "raid" component is still a "soft" raid, not a true hardware raid (but then again, this is the nvidia nForce3 chipset, not the VIA chipset)
I have an asus k8v se. My primary disk is a Seagate SATA, my second an old PATA. No problems at all. (I never used the on board promise controller, only the vt8237) JR Pierre Patino wrote:
